Korea's Top 1% Investors Buy Samsung, Take Profits on SK Hynix
Reports say Korea's top 1% high-net-worth investors have recently bought Samsung Electronics common shares while trimming SK Hynix to lock in profits. The move reflects large funds rebalancing after SK Hynix's sharp AI-memory rally. It could create near-term selling pressure on SK Hynix, but if capital rotates into Samsung it may signal continued sector interest, making the net impact neutral.
